OV9650_software_application_notes1.03.pdf

根据提供的文档信息,我们可以深入探讨OV9650/OV9653摄像头模块软件应用笔记中的关键知识点。这份文档提供了详细的指导和技术建议,旨在帮助用户更好地理解和利用OV9650/OV9653摄像头模块的功能。 ### 1. 如何选择输出格式? 在选择输出格式时,需要考虑后端处理器的能力。根据文档中的描述,可以分为以下几种情况: #### 1.1 后端带有完整的ISP 当后端具备完整的图像信号处理(ISP)能力时,可以直接使用ISP来处理图像数据,无需对摄像头模块进行额外设置。 #### 1.2 后端带有YCbCr ISP 如果后端支持YCbCr格式的ISP,则可以通过调整摄像头模块的输出格式为YCbCr,以便与后端系统兼容。 #### 1.3 后端不带ISP 如果后端系统不包含ISP,则需要通过软件方式对图像数据进行处理。此时,摄像头模块可以输出原始数据格式(如RAW),以便于后端进行进一步处理。 #### 1.4 转换格式的公式 文档中还提供了一些转换不同格式的公式,这些公式可以帮助开发者在不同格式之间进行转换,确保图像数据能够在不同的系统中正确显示。 ### 2. 如何选择输出分辨率? 选择合适的输出分辨率对于优化图像质量和性能至关重要。 #### 2.1 后端带有ISP 当后端系统配备了ISP时,可以根据实际需求调整摄像头模块的分辨率,ISP会负责后续的图像处理任务。 #### 2.2 后端不带ISP 如果后端没有ISP,那么就需要在摄像头模块上直接设置合适的分辨率,以便于软件处理。 ### 3. 如何调整帧率 帧率是衡量视频流畅度的关键指标之一,文档提供了几种在不同输入时钟频率下调整帧率的方法。 #### 3.1 VGA预览,30fps,24MHz输入时钟 为了实现VGA分辨率下的30fps帧率,需要确保输入时钟为24MHz,并调整摄像头模块的相关参数。 #### 3.2 VGA预览,15fps,24MHz输入时钟 如果希望降低帧率至15fps,同时保持相同的输入时钟频率,可以通过调整摄像头模块的配置来实现。 #### 3.3 VGA预览,25fps,24MHz输入时钟 为了获得更高的帧率(25fps),需要相应地调整摄像头模块的参数,以适应更高的帧率要求。 #### 3.4 VGA预览,12.5fps,24MHz输入时钟 如果需要进一步降低帧率至12.5fps,同样需要调整摄像头模块的配置。 #### 3.5 SXGA捕获,7.5fps,24MHz输入时钟 对于SXGA分辨率的捕获,为了达到7.5fps的帧率,需要相应地调整摄像头模块的配置。 #### 3.6 SXGA捕获,6.25fps,24MHz输入时钟 如果需要更低的帧率(6.25fps),则需要相应地调整摄像头模块的参数。 ### 4. 如何设置夜视模式预览 夜视模式通常用于光线较暗的环境中,可以通过调整摄像头模块的设置来增强暗光环境下的图像质量。 ### 5. 如何消除预览模式中的光带 光带问题通常是由于光源闪烁引起的,文档中提到了几种方法来解决这个问题: #### 5.1 光带现象 首先需要识别出光带现象,确定是否由光源闪烁引起。 #### 5.2 消除光带 文档中提供了一种方法来消除光带,即通过调整摄像头模块的参数来减轻或消除这种现象。 #### 5.3 根据区域信息选择带状滤波器 还可以根据摄像头捕捉到的不同区域的信息来选择合适的带状滤波器,以进一步改善图像质量。 #### 5.4 消除捕获模式下的光带 对于捕获模式,也需要采取相应的措施来消除光带。 #### 5.5 当无法消除光带时 如果采取了所有可能的措施仍然无法消除光带,可能需要重新评估硬件配置或更换光源。 ### 6. 白平衡调整 白平衡是确保在不同光照条件下颜色还原准确的重要功能。 #### 6.1 简单的白平衡 文档提供了一种简单的白平衡调整方法,适用于基本的应用场景。 #### 6.2 高级白平衡 对于更复杂的应用场景,文档还提供了一种高级的白平衡调整方法,可以更精确地控制色彩还原。 #### 6.3 如何选择合适的白平衡 根据实际需求和应用场景,选择合适的白平衡调整方法是非常重要的。 ### 7. 缺陷像素校正 缺陷像素校正是提高图像质量的重要步骤,文档中提供了相关的指导和建议。 ### 8. BLC (背景光补偿) 背景光补偿功能可以帮助在背光较强的环境下改善图像质量。 ### 9. 视频模式 文档中还介绍了如何设置视频模式,以适应不同的视频录制需求。 ### 10. 数字变焦 数字变焦是一种通过软件算法实现的变焦效果,文档提供了关于如何设置数字变焦的指导。 ### 11. OV9650/OV9653 的功能 #### 11.1 光模式 根据不同的光照条件,可以调整摄像头模块的工作模式,以获得最佳的图像质量。 #### 11.2 色彩饱和度 通过调整色彩饱和度,可以改善图像的整体观感。 #### 11.3 亮度 亮度调整是调整图像整体明暗程度的重要手段。 #### 11.4 对比度 对比度调整可以增强图像的细节表现力。 #### 11.5 特效 摄像头模块还支持多种特效模式,可以根据具体应用场景来选择合适的特效。 ### 12. 处理镜头问题 #### 12.1 光照衰减 光照衰减是指图像边缘亮度较中心低的现象,文档中提供了解决方案。 #### 12.2 镜头校正 为了改善由镜头引起的图像失真问题,文档提供了一些校正方法。 #### 12.3 不同供应商提供的不同镜头 针对使用不同供应商提供的镜头的情况,文档给出了一些建议。 #### 12.4 黑角 黑角是指图像四个角落出现黑色或亮度明显低于中心部分的现象,文档中提供了解决方案。 #### 12.5 分辨率 摄像头模块的分辨率直接影响到图像的清晰度,文档中提供了一些关于如何选择合适分辨率的指导。 #### 12.6 光学对比度 光学对比度是指图像中黑白对比的程度,文档提供了一些调整方法。 #### 12.7 镜头盖 文档还提到了使用镜头盖的情况,以及如何正确使用以避免影响图像质量。 ### 13. 参考设置 文档最后提供了一些参考设置,可以帮助用户快速上手并进行基本的设置。 OV9650/OV9653摄像头模块软件应用笔记为用户提供了全面的技术指导和支持,涵盖了从输出格式、分辨率、帧率调整到各种高级功能的设置,旨在帮助用户充分利用摄像头模块的各项功能,提高图像质量和性能。

















- cwzshr2014-01-07下载下来,忘了看还是没看了!是ov9650的配置

- 粉丝: 2
我的内容管理 展开
我的资源 快来上传第一个资源
我的收益
登录查看自己的收益我的积分 登录查看自己的积分
我的C币 登录后查看C币余额
我的收藏
我的下载
下载帮助


最新资源
- 高性能电机控制系统的可编程逻辑器件实现技术.docx
- 国内外主流三维GIS软件比较与应用分析.docx
- 基于HyperMAML算法的轴承小样本故障诊断研究与应用探索.docx
- 基于OBE理念的AI驱动软件工程专业教学改革模式构建.docx
- 基于大模型的腹腔镜胆囊切除术健康教育材料研究.docx
- 基于大数据分析的银行信贷风险管理优化策略.docx
- 基于图卷积自适应处理的水下图像质量提升算法研究.docx
- 基于智能算法的制造车间AGV路径优化与任务协同调度机制分析.docx
- 激光点云数据在单木胸径测量中的应用:最优切片厚度算法研究.docx
- 基于注意力机制的水下光流估算新算法研究.docx
- 教育大数据视野下的教学效果测量研究:评价指标体系构建与应用创新.docx
- 焦炭CSR和CRI性能预测:决策树算法在工业领域的应用.docx
- 精密机床动态误差补偿算法优化与应用.docx
- 企业市场营销模式创新:人工智能的角色与应用探索.docx
- 轻量化YOLOv7算法在钢材表面缺陷检测中的应用研究.docx
- 人工智能赋能的运筹学课程混合式教学模式构建与应用研究.docx


